Photoimageable nozzle member for reduced fluid cross-contamination and method therefor
11577513 · 2023-02-14 · ·

A nozzle plate of a fluid ejection head for a fluid ejection device, a fluid ejection head containing the nozzle plate, and a method for making the fluid ejection head containing the nozzle plate. The nozzle plate contains two or more arrays of nozzle holes therein and a barrier structure disposed on an exposed surface of the nozzle plate between adjacent arrays of nozzle holes, wherein the barrier structure deters cross-contamination of fluids between the adjacent arrays of nozzle holes.

ACTUATOR, LIQUID DISCHARGE HEAD, LIQUID DISCHARGE DEVICE, AND LIQUID DISCHARGE APPARATUS

An actuator includes a deformable thin-film member having an opening, an electromechanical conversion element disposed at a periphery of the opening of the deformable thin-film member, an insulating film covering the electromechanical conversion element, a protective film over a surface of the insulating film, the protective film covering the surface of the insulating film and a surface of an electrode wiring connected to the electromechanical conversion element, and an adhesion improving film disposed between the electrode wiring and the protective film.

LIQUID DISCHARGING HEAD AND INK-JET APPARATUS

A liquid discharging head includes a nozzle configured to discharge liquid, a pressure chamber communicated with the nozzle, and an individual channel communicated with the pressure chamber through a narrow part. The liquid discharging head also includes a common channel communicated with the individual channel, an energy generation element configured to generate energy, and a diaphragm configured to convey the energy to the pressure chamber. A metal oxide film is formed at inner walls of the nozzle, the pressure chamber, the narrow part, the diaphragm, and the individual channel, and a hydroxyl group has come out from the metal oxide film.

Actuator, liquid discharge head, liquid discharge apparatus, and method of manufacturing actuator
11518165 · 2022-12-06 · ·

An actuator includes a substrate, a diaphragm on the substrate, a lower electrode on the diaphragm, a piezoelectric body on the lower electrode, and an upper electrode on the piezoelectric body. A ratio of lead (Pb) and zirconium (Zr) in atomic percent (atm %) present at a grain boundary in the piezoelectric body satisfies a relation of Pb/Zr>1.7.

FLOW PATH MEMBER AND LIQUID DISCHARGE HEAD
20230055886 · 2023-02-23 ·

A flow path member includes a first substrate having a first surface that has a flow path, and includes a second substrate having a second surface opposing the first surface. In the flow path member in which the first and second substrates are joined together with adhesive provided between the first and second surfaces, a groove is formed in at least one of the first and second surfaces. When the first substrate is viewed from a direction orthogonal to the first surface, the flow path is disposed on a groove inner side. The groove has a first portion having a first depth and a second portion having a second depth shallower than the first depth. The second portion is that portion of the groove existing inside a region surrounded by an outer edge of the first surface and extension lines of two sides that form a flow path corner.
